Core Insights - The collaboration between SynaXG, Keysight Technologies, and Arm aims to enhance energy efficiency in Open RAN (O-RAN) through realistic traffic testing and validation [1][2][3] - SynaXG's ultra-low-power O-DU/CU is designed to set a new industry benchmark for energy efficiency in O-RAN networks, reducing power consumption by up to 30% [6] - The partnership focuses on ensuring that O-RAN deployments meet stringent energy efficiency benchmarks while maintaining carrier-grade reliability [2][3] Company Overview - SynaXG is recognized as a leader in AI-driven RAN solutions, providing scalable and energy-efficient platforms for mobile carriers and private networks [6] - Keysight Technologies is an S&P 500 company that delivers market-leading design, emulation, and test solutions across various industries, including communications and industrial automation [5] Technological Advancements - The integration of Keysight's KORA solutions with SynaXG's O-DU/CU allows for extensive carrier-grade traffic testing, confirming the performance and efficiency of O-RAN networks [2][3] - The Arm architecture utilized in SynaXG's solutions enables operators to deploy O-RAN at scale while significantly reducing power demand [2][3] Industry Impact - The collaboration is positioned to address sustainability challenges in the telecommunications sector by significantly reducing power consumption in next-generation networks [3] - The advancements in energy efficiency are expected to cut operational costs for telecom operators, enhancing the overall sustainability of network deployments [6]
